"PROJECT RUNWAY ALL STARS" RETURNS FOR BIGGEST SEASON YET ON JANUARY 4 PITTING ROOKIES AGAINST VETS

Guest Judges For Season Six Include Catherine Zeta-Jones, Whoopi Goldberg, Dita Von Teese, Jesse Tyler Ferguson, Olivia Culpo, RuPaul, Kelly Osbourne, and Many Others

New York, NY (December 11, 2017) -- Sixteen talented designers will compete for a second chance at runway gold with the return of Lifetime's hit series Project Runway All Stars, premiering Thursday, January 4 at 9pm ET/PT. Eight All Stars veterans will go up against eight former Runway designers making it to the All Stars battle ground for the very first time. Alyssa Milano returns as host with judges Isaac Mizrahi and Georgina Chapman and Anne Fulenwider, Editor-in-Chief of Marie Claire joining as mentor.

Guest judges strutting down the runway this season to see who has the skills to make it to the end include Catherine Zeta-Jones, Whoopi Goldberg, Dita Von Teese, Jesse Tyler Ferguson, Rebecca Minkoff, Danielle Brooks, Olivia Culpo, Rosie Perez, RuPaul, Kelly Osbourne, Karolina Kurkova, Kasey Musgraves, and Project Runway's Nina Garcia and Zac Posen.

The Rookies Are:

Kimberly Goldson from Brooklyn, NY - PR Season 9

Stanley Hudson from Los Angeles, CA - PR Season 11

Amanda Valentine from Nashville, TN - PR Season 13

Char Glover from Los Angeles, CA - PR Season 13

Kelly Dempsey from Boston, MA - PR Season 14

Edmond Newton from Atlanta, GA - PR Season 14

Candice Cuoco from Oakland, CA - PR Season 14

Merline Labissiere from Miami, FL - PR Season 14

The Vets Are:

Anthony Williams from Atlanta, GA - PR Season 7, PRAS Season 1

Joshua McKinley from New York NY - PR Season 9, PRAS Season 2

Casanova from New York, NY - PR Season 8, PRAS Season 2

Ari South from Honolulu, HI - PR Season 8, PRAS Season 3

Melissa Fleis from Los Angeles, CA - PR Season 10, PRAS Season 3

Fabio Costa from New York, NY - PR Season 10, PRAS Season 4

Helen Castillo from Weehawken, NJ - PR Season 12, PRAS Season 4

Ken Laurence from Atlanta, GA - PR Season 12, PRAS Season 5

The winner of Project Runway All Stars Season six will receive a fashion spread in Marie Claire magazine and a position as contributing editor for a year, and a complete sewing studio from Brother Sewing and Embroidery. The winner also receives a once in a lifetime trip to London, England, and luxurious skincare and makeup from Rodial and accessories and styling services from Intermix, to enhance their next collection. To top it all off, the winner receives a $100,000 grand prize to elevate their business and build their brand.
